Summary:
A nonexempt position responsible for nursing care under the direct supervision of the RN Clinic Manager. Position involves medication administration, wound care; providing nursing care as ordered in day center, clinic and/or homecare settings.

QUALIFICATIONS: High school diploma, successful completion of an accredited Practical Nursing Program, Board exam, and licensure to practice in NJ. Minimum one year of LPN experience; clinic or LTC setting experience preferred. At least 1 year working with frail and elderly population. Computer experience required. State-licensed practical nurse, Current CPR Certification, Valid driver's license.

As a multisite provider of PACE community-based services for seniors in Cumberland, Gloucester, and Salem Counties, an Inspira LIFE employee may work at either or both the Vineland or Williamstown LIFE Program as census changes or operational needs occur to meet the needs of our participants.

Position Responsibilities
    • Dispensing and documentation of medications as per PCP orders.
    • Perform wound care, as ordered by PCP.
    • Screen participants for evaluation by PCP.
    • Assist with prioritizing appointments to see PCP.
    • Obtains vital signs, weights, and identifies reason for visit prior to exam by PCP.
    • Obtains EKGs as ordered.
    • Obtains lab work as ordered.
    • Educating participant on follow-up visits and specific orders.
    • Home Visits to ensure compliance with medication, follow-up with wound care orders.
    • Provides CPR if needed.
    • Medication reconciliation.
    • Assist with change of oxygen tanks when needed.
    • Documents all care in EMR timely and accurately.
    • Assists with Scheduling of necessary appointments of participants for clinic.
    • Performs physician order reconciliation post ED/Hospitalizations, Specialists' visits, Pain Mgmt. Clinic, etc.
    • Consults each day with the Clinical staff on managing the participant flow for the day. Assists in prioritizing the scheduling of participants.
    • Greets participants that enter the Clinic with a smile and pleasant voice and maintains eye contact.
    • Maintains the confidentiality of all procedures, results and information about participants, clients, or families.
    • Performs other duties as requested by immediate supervisor.
    • Competent in documenting in EHR as required.
    • Immunizations to participants and accurate documentation into the EHR.
